What You’ll Need

Prepare your printer for cleaning by gathering the following items:

  • Soft lint-free cloth
  • Distilled water (avoid tap water, as it can leave mineral residue)
  • Isopropyl alcohol (for stubborn ink stains)
  • Q-tips or cotton swabs
  • A small bowl for water
  • Paper towels

These supplies will help you effectively clean the components of your inkjet printer without damaging delicate parts.

How to Clean Your Inkjet Printer in 6 Easy Steps

Cleaning your inkjet printer might seem like a daunting task, but it’s really just a matter of taking it step by step. It’s easy to make your printer look brand new again with this quick and easy guide.

Step 1: Remove the ink cartridges and turn off the machine

Your printer should be turned off and unplugged from its power source. Before cleaning, this step is necessary to avoid any accidents. Once the printer is off, carefully remove the ink cartridges. Be cautious not to touch the nozzles or ink openings of the cartridges, as this could lead to ink smudging or clogging.

Step 2: Prepare the cartridges for cleaning

To clean your clothes, dampen them with distilled water (don’t use tap water). By wiping the cartridge heads gently, you can make sure that they are clean and free of dried ink or dust. Use a Q-tip if you want to be more precise when cleaning around the delicate parts. When dealing with stubborn stains, be sure to use a small amount of isopropyl alcohol on the cloth to dissolve ink residue.

Cleaning the cartridges will keep the ink flowing smoothly, which is crucial for consistent print quality.

Step 3: Ensure that the ribbon is clean

The ribbon is another area that might accumulate ink residue. Using a slightly dampened cloth, gently wipe down the ribbon to remove any ink buildup. If the ribbon is particularly dirty, consider using a small amount of alcohol to clean it. This step will help maintain smooth printing, preventing ink smears or blotches.

Step 4: Clean the Cartridge Housing

Now that the cartridges are clean, it’s time to turn your attention to the printer’s cartridge housing. This is the area where the cartridges sit inside the printer. Use a lint-free cloth dampened with distilled water to wipe the inside of the housing, removing any ink residue or debris that may have accumulated. Be careful around the electrical components and other delicate parts of the printer.

A clean cartridge housing ensures that your printer doesn’t experience paper jams or ink misalignment when printing.

Step 5: Oil the Stabiliser Bar

The stabilizer bar helps to keep your printer’s moving parts in place, reducing friction. Over time, dust and ink can accumulate on the bar, making it harder for the printer to function smoothly. To clean it, lightly oil the stabilizer bar with a tiny drop of printer oil or lubricating oil. Gently rub it with a soft cloth to spread the oil evenly. You will reduce the risk of wear and tear by keeping your printer’s mechanical parts working smoothly.

Step 6: Reinsert the Cartridges

Once everything is clean, carefully reinsert the ink cartridges into their respective slots. Make sure they are securely seated in place. Turn your printer back on, and you may need to perform a test print to ensure everything is working as it should. If you notice that the print quality is still poor, a cleaning cycle via your printer’s software can help clear up any remaining issues.

Frequently Asked Questions

Should I Clean My Inkjet Printer Regularly?

Yes, it’s recommended to clean your printer every 2-3 months to maintain print quality and prevent clogging.

Is It Safe to Use Rubbing Alcohol on the Ink Cartridges?

Yes, but only in small amounts. Avoid soaking the cartridges as excessive liquid can damage the internal components.

Will Cleaning My Inkjet Printer Improve Its Print Quality?

Yes, cleaning your printer helps remove ink buildup and dust, improving the print quality and preventing issues like streaks and smudging.
